Factors Influencing COVID-19 Vaccine Refusal in an Unstable SocioPolitical Area: The Case of Eastern of the Democratic Republic Congo

Abstract: The purpose of this research was to identify factors that affect the resistance of the population of eastern DR Congo to be vaccinated against Covid-19. Therefore, quantitative research based on primary data obtained from a survey was conducted in North Kivu Province. The questionnaire had 35 items with 410 respondents. After processing of the data, 318 records were retained. There were 151 women (48.55%) and 160 men (51.45%).
